The immune system is our body’s defense mechanism against harmful pathogens and diseases. Keeping our immune system strong and functioning optimally is essential for overall health and well-being. While there are medications and vaccines that can help boost immunity, there are also natural ways to enhance the immune system.
One of the most important aspects of boosting the immune system is maintaining a healthy lifestyle. This includes eating a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ins. These foods are packed with v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ants that can help strengthen the immune system. It is also crucial to stay hydrated and drink plenty of water to help flush out toxins from the body.
Regular exercise is another key factor in supporting a healthy immune system. Exercise helps improve circulation, which allows immune cells to move freely throughout the body. It also reduces stress hormones, which can weaken the immune system.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ate exercise, such as brisk walking, biking, or swimming, most days of the week.
Adequate sleep is essential for a strong immune system. During sleep, the body repairs and regenerates cells, including immune cells.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night to support your immune system.
Reducing stress is also crucial for boosting immunity. Chronic stress can suppress the immune system, making us more susceptible to infections. Practice relaxation techniques such as deep breathing, meditation, yoga, or hypnotherapy to reduce stress and improve immune function.
In addition to lifestyle factors, there are also natural supplements that can help boost the immune system. Vitamin C, vitamin D, zinc, and probiotics are known for their immune-boosting properties. However, it is important to consult with a healthcare professional before taking any supplements to ensure they are safe and effective for you.
It is also essential to avoid smoking and limit alcohol consumption, as these can weaken the immune system and make us more vulnerable to infections.
In conclusion, there are many natural ways to boost the immune system and support overall health. By maintaining a healthy lifestyle, getting regular exercise, eating a balanced diet, getting enough sleep, managing stress, and taking supplements, we can enhance our immune function and stay healthy. Remember to consult with a healthcare professional before making any significant changes to your lifestyle or starting any new supplements.
